*Spring Break* Bisqueware Painting Open Studio
This open studio option is specific for young artists that enjoy painting things! Bisqueware is pottery the has already been made and fired - your job is to creatively decorate the piece with your choice of glaze (paint) combinations. We've got lots of bisqueware pieces to choose from - giraffes, sharks, turtles, cats, bowls, mugs, vases, and more - and even more glazes to paint on them!
